Jimmie Louise Schmidt went to be with the Lord on June 28, 2023, at the age of 82. She was born January 06, 1941, in Brady, Tx to the late Roy and Mary Lura Black.                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                              Jimmie graduated from Mason High School in 1959. She married Henry Gary Schmidt June 20, 1959. They raised their two children Cindy and Jim on their ranch in Streeter.

Jimmie was a loving wife, sister, mother, grandmother, great-grandmother, and aunt. She spent her life on the Schmidt Ranch raising sheep, goats, and cattle. When she wasn't working livestock, she was in the kitchen concocting new recipes for her cookbook which was shared all over the country thanks to her sponsor Zebco Corporation.

Jimmie spent many years as a MYF leader. She loved to paint wildlife, play bridge with the ladies, take vacations with her family and friends, and volunteer in her community. She was a talented seamstress and carpenter as well. Jimmie was known to sit countless hours in deer blinds scouting animals. Her love for the outdoors and wildlife led her to open Raz exotic sale and Mason Auction Market with her husband Gary.
